Who are we?
Founded in 2009, Creative Snacks Co. (CSC) is a maker of healthy natural and organic snacks. The Creative Snacks brand is sold in the United States, Canada, and Caribbean along with some private label and bulk products. The product portfolio includes branded and private label self-manufactured decadent snack clusters, snack trail mixes, dried fruits and nuts, and coated pretzels. Opened in January 2017, the High Point/Greensboro North Carolina plant is a 92,000 square foot climate controlled facility. Operations include a bakery, mixing, rigid container and pouch primary packaging, secondary package customization, warehousing, and customer order fulfillment. In October 2019, KIND LLC acquired the Creative Snacks business. In November 2020, Mars, Incorporated acquired full ownership in KIND LLC.
